The releases/gcc-11 branch has been updated by Eric Botcazou
<ebotcazou@gcc.gnu.org>:

https://gcc.gnu.org/g:53e85b38aaa10f5f8fe35eeea454a92c293cbc67

commit r11-8271-g53e85b38aaa10f5f8fe35eeea454a92c293cbc67
Author: Eric Botcazou <ebotcazou@adacore.com>
Date:   Wed Apr 21 11:18:21 2021 +0200

    Add stopgap fix for PR ada/99360

    gcc/ada/
            PR ada/99360
            * exp_ch6.adb (Might_Have_Tasks): Return False when the type is the
            class-wide type of a predefined iterator type.
